About this route:
A direct, nonstop flight between Maningrida Airport (MNG), Maningrida, Northern Territory, Australia and Wallops Flight Facility Airport (WAL), Wallops Island, Virginia, United States would travel a Great Circle distance of 9,879 miles (or 15,898 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Maningrida Airport and Wallops Flight Facility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Wallops Flight Facility Airport (WAL):
- The Wallops mobile range instrumentation includes telemetry, radar, command and power systems.
- In 1998, the Virginia Commercial Space Flight Authority, later joined by Maryland, built the Mid-Atlantic Regional Spaceport at Wallops on land leased from NASA.
- The Wallops Flight Facility also supports science missions for the National Oceanic and Atmospheric Administration and occasionally for foreign governments and commercial organizations.
